AI Summary
-
Municipalities (counties, cities, and towns) are prohibited from charging permit, license, inspection, or other fees for residential improvements needed to accommodate a veteran's disability
-
Applies to veterans with physical or mental impairments that have received a disability rating under federal law (38 U.S.C.)
-
Municipalities cannot refuse to issue permits or conduct inspections based on nonpayment of these waived fees
-
Veterans must still complete all required applications and documentation, and must provide proof of veteran status and attest that the improvement accommodates their disability
-
Effective the day following final enactment
Legislative Description
Imposition of certain fees for residential improvements necessary to accommodate the disability of a veteran prohibited.
